The Motley Fool Everlasting portfolio is a premium investing service which gives real-time access to CEO Tom Gardner’s investing account, you’ll get every holding, allocation and return.

It’s a real-money portfolio that contains only the stocks that Tom considers the best of the best in the market today. So far his portfolio has returned 336% in 8 years (As of Oct 27th 2022) and he believeds the greatest growth is still yet to come.

So… what exactly does the Everlasting Portfolio offer, what can you do with it and is it ultimately worth the money? We’ll do our best to answer that for you.

First… the stocks in his account are considered the “best of the best” and the Fool states they are “the only publicly traded stocks he personally owns — and the only publicly traded stocks he will buy for the rest of his life…”.

The investments in Tom’s account are guided not only by the research of his own team of roughly 50 analysts but also by David Garner’s team of analysts and every other Motley Fool premium service including all 700+ active stock recommendations.

The Everlasting Portfolio may be the cheapest and most direct way to get front row access to all of the Motley Fool’s best stock picks and is the only service where you can see allocation and re-investment strategies in action and how they impact overall performance.

What You Get:

  • Stock Recommendations with Real-time Portfolio Alerts
  • Buy Alerts – These alerts occur as they happen and not on a set schedule like the Fool’s other services.
  • Sell Alerts – As Tom sell’s a position or reduces a position you get the alert.
  • Allocation – You’ll get to see every stock allocation in his portfolio, how he allocates new holdings and how he adjusts over-time.
  • Everlasting Portfolio Investment Guides – Tom’s personal investment philosophy, strategies for selling, key principles for winning as an investor and a complete guide on how to get the started with the service.

Everlasting Portfolio Pricing

The Everlasting Portfolio price is $2,999/year but is currently on promo for $1,599/year.

Refund Policy

While other services like the flagship Motley Fool Stock Advisor service or Rule Breakers come with 30-day membership-fee-back guarantees, the Everlasting Portfolio is a little different. It doesn’t offer a 30 day refund option, but they do allow you to transfer the price of the service to another portfolio service within the first 30 days.

Did you know that...

  • Anchoring bias can cause investors to rely heavily on the first piece of information they encounter (like an initial stock price) and ignore subsequent data?
  • Some investors consider stock buybacks as a positive signal because they can increase earnings per share and show management's confidence in the company's future?
  • Bond values typically decline when interest rates go up because new bonds offer higher yields, making existing bonds with lower yields less attractive?
  • Avoiding the stock market due to fear of volatility can lead to missed wealth-building opportunities, especially if you have a long investment horizon?
  • Regularly rebalancing your portfolio ensures it aligns with your intended asset allocation and risk tolerance?
